∙ 11y agoMost magma originates in the asthenosphere, which is a semi-fluid layer located in the upper mantle. Magma forms here due to the high temperatures and pressures that facilitate the melting of rock.
Most magma originates from the Earth's mantle, which is the layer beneath the crust. Magma forms due to the melting of rocks under high temperatures and pressures deep within the mantle. This molten rock can then rise towards the Earth's surface through volcanic activity.

No, magma is not the source of all rocks on Earth. Rocks can form through various processes such as cooling and solidification of lava, compression of sediment, and metamorphism of existing rocks. Magma is one of the sources of igneous rocks, but not all rocks originate from magma.
Most magma is foound in upper portions of the mantle near plate boundaries or at hot spots, but some is found in the crust in magma chambers.
